Logging in DBCP

Ich benutze Apache Commons DBCP. Es ist eine Aufgabe, das innere Verhalten des DBCP zu verfolgen - Anzahl der aktiven und inaktiven Verbindungen.

Ich habe herausgefunden, dass DBCP überhaupt keine solche Protokollierung hat. Ja, es ist möglich, den Code zu schreiben, der den Status der BasicDataSource ausgibt, wenn die Verbindung aus dem Pool ausgeliehen wird. Es gibt jedoch keine Möglichkeit, den Status der BasicDataSource zu verfolgen, wenn die Verbindung zurückgegeben oder geschlossen wird, da das Verbindungsobjekt nichts über den Pool weiß.

Irgendwelche Ideen

Antworten auf die Frage(8)

Ihre Antwort auf die Frage